The final cost to clean your air ducts depends on a few straightforward factors. We look at the total square footage of your home, the number of individual vents and returns you have, and how many separate HVAC units are running the system. If your ducts have heavy debris buildup or require specialized attention for mold or deep-seated allergens, that will also influence the labor involved. Professional cleaning goes beyond a basic dusting; it involves using industrial-grade vacuums to reach deep inside the system to pull out hidden debris. You should request this if you are concerned about indoor air quality or if your system has not been serviced in a long time. Keeping ducts clean helps the system operate as intended, which is especially important after construction projects or if you have family members with asthma or allergies.
Summer heat puts a heavy demand on your cooling system. If your ducts are clogged, your AC has to work harder to push air through, which can impact your comfort and energy usage. A professional cleaning keeps your airflow strong and helps your system maintain a cool, consistent temperature all summer long.

Look for excessive dust accumulation around your air vents or a noticeable increase in dust on surfaces throughout your home, especially after cleaning. A persistent musty or unusual odor when your HVAC system is running is also a strong indicator that your ducts may need attention.
It can make a significant difference in your home's air quality. Removing accumulated dust, allergens, pet dander, and other debris from your ductwork leads to cleaner air circulation. This often results in a fresher-smelling home and can alleviate allergy symptoms for Glendale residents.
Common signs include increased dust in your home, recurring allergy or respiratory issues, and unusual odors when your heating or cooling system is on. Visible dust or debris around your air vents is a clear indicator that it's time for professional attention in Glendale.
